Pests can be dealt with if you seek advice from experienced reefers. Two varieties of worm (hermodice carunculata and eunicid) are a problem. Most crabs are problems. The rest of the life tends to be good. Your problems usually show up hunting food somewhere during the several weeks of cycle, and can be bottle-trapped and moved to the sump (where they're safe) or disposed of.
